Mass protests have spread across the nation over the death of George Floyd, but some wonder if this could cause an unintentional spread of COVID-19.
KSN News spoke to Dr. Robert Witter, KU Medical Center-Wichita infectious disease.
"Whenever you're gathering in a large group, particularly with people you don't know, COVID-19 is a possible risk," said Witter.
Dr. Wittler says there are a number of things protestors can do to ensure they're keeping themselves safe and those around them. He recommends trying to keep space in between groups of people, wearing protective gear, such as masks or gloves, and making sure not to touch your eyes, or nose.
